Frank Raley, Jr., 90, of Noblesville, passed away on Thursday, October 14, 2010 at Riverview Hospital in Noblesville. He was born on July 21, 1920 to Frank and Mae (Smith) Raley in Clay City, Illinois.
Frank had worked as a carpenter with Foley Construction in Detroit, Michigan for many years. He was a WWII Army veteran and attended Emmanuel United Methodist Church in Noblesville. He loved the outdoors, and enjoyed gardening, feeding the birds, horsehoes and sports in general (especially baseball).
Frank is survived by his wife, Elizabeth; a son, Wayne (Lourdes) Raley of Fishers; and two Grandchildren, Alena Raley Faith of Avon and Justin Raley of Fishers.
He was preceded in death by his parents.
